Is Life Worth Living?

Is life worth living?
Ask the young man with Lou
Gehrig's disease who clings to life
With a tenacious will.
Ask the young woman with
Stage four breast cancer
Throwing up in a bed pan
After her chemotherapy.
Ask the sixty something man
Waiting for a liver transplant.
Ask the weeping mother as she
Holds her newborn baby with a
Defective heart that has a 20%
Chance of living.
Ask the combat veteran whose
Legs, arms, and eyes were blown
Away by a landmine.
Ask them, then ask me.
